Rolf Bartkiewicz

          He was born in Brandenburg (Germany). As a student of secondary school of music he played in a symphony orchestra in Kalisz. He graduated from the Music Academy in Lodz in the flute class, he won the International Flute Competition in Wloszakowice. He perfected his skills in college in Switzerland in the concert class of prof. Peter Lucas Graf. After returning home he started a career as a soloist, I-st Carpathian Philharmonic flutist, which continues to this day. He spent 1986 in Lodz, where he played in the local Philharmonic of Lodz. He Also cooperated with the Lodz Radio Orchestra, Philharmonic Orchestra of Lvov and the majority of Polish symphony and chamber orchestras. In 1992 he moved to Cairo, where he worked as first flutist with the National Orchestra of Egypt. Then he founded a chamber music trio "The New Bartoldy Ensemble", with which he performed in Egypt.
Rolf Bartkiewicz is an outstanding flautist, concertmaster and soloist virtuoso endowed with special talent. His repertoire includes most of the best flute concerts, so with classical and contemporary music. He records for radio and TV. As a soloist, chamber and orchestral musician he has performed in almost all countries of Western Europe, Czechoslovakia, the former Soviet republics, Denmark, Switzerland, Spain, Taiwan, Mexico, Brazil, USA, Egypt and South Korea. Rolf Bartkiewicz is a musician who is able to charm his audience with his playing, man full of charm and humor, great culture and quiet elegance.

Hi plays on the golden flute "Emanuel."

* Technician, corrector of the upright pianos and grand pianos.
He graduated from Technical School of Mechanical Pianos in Kalisz. He worked in factories of pianos in Poland (Calisia), Germany (Bluthner) and the Czech Republic (Petrof). Two years he worked in the largest Swiss piano factory - Piano-Haus - he repaired and sold instruments, and in the piano-Stein Company in Basel. Since 25 years he runs his own business.
